The contract clause at Federal Acquisition Regulation 52.223-6 requires (1) contract employees to notify their employer of any criminal drug statute conviction for a violation occurring in the workplace; and (2) Government contractors, after receiving notice of such conviction, to notify the contracting officer.
The information collection requirement in the FAR remains unchanged with the exception of the annual public burden and cost and estimated cost to the government. The figures have been updated to reflect updated calculations.
